Adoption details
The adoption process at the Goulburn Mulwaree Animal Shelter is relatively easy. We ask that if you are interested in an animal, please apply via pet rescue, the Shelter staff will then review applications and phone selected applicants for a meet and greet. We do not take expressions of interest over the phone.
Once you have been selected as the right applicant for the animal, all that is required by you is to make a payment at the Animal Shelter by eftpos ONLY (Via phone can be arranged after a meet and greet with the animal), provide details for the microchip and registration paperwork and then pick up your future pet from the Council veterinary service provider once they have been de-sexed and vaccinated, if not already desexed and vaccinated (Council staff will advise you when the animal is booked in at the veterinary clinic.
The following are the re-homing fees for dogs and cats,
Entire Dog (to be desexed after adoption) - $350.00
De-sexed Dog (de-sexed by previous owner) - $250.00
Entire Cat (to be desexed after adoption) - $250.00
De-sexed Cat (de-sexed by previous owner) - $150.00
Entire Dog( to be desexed after adoption) 8years or older - $250.00
De-sexed Dog (de-sexed by previous owner) 8 years or older - $150.00
Entire Cat (to be desexed after adoption) 8 years or older - $150.00
De-sexed Cat (de-sexed by previous owner) 8 years or older $100.00
The following is included with all sales,
Microchipping (identification details will be placed on the NSW Companion Animal Register)
Lifetime Registration (within NSW)
Vaccination
Worm, flea & tick treatment
Vet Check
De-sexing (if required)
Adoption pack
Please Note: All dogs and cats rescued from the Goulburn Mulwaree Animal Shelter are required to be de-sexed. Dogs and cats will not be sold as entire under any circumstances.
